Aplos is a specialized software designed to cater to the needs of non-profits and churches, focusing on fund accounting, donor management, and fundraising. Its fund accounting feature is tailored to help organizations track and report on their finances, including designated funds, with simplicity and compliance in mind. FAQs About Elexio Community vs Aplos

In comparing Elexio Community and Aplos, both platforms offer robust solutions for church and nonprofit management, yet cater to slightly different needs. Elexio Community excels in providing a comprehensive church management system with features tailored for congregation engagement and growth. Aplos, on the other hand, shines in its financial management capabilities, making it ideal for nonprofits focused on accounting and donor management. Ultimately, the choice between the two depends on whether an organization prioritizes community engagement or financial oversight.
